| 2024-30598 | Security Zone, Port of Miami, Florida | Rule | The Coast Guard is changing the existing Port of Miami fixed security zone regulation that encompasses certain navigable waters of the Miami Main Channel in Miami, FL. The change is designed to extend the existing fixed security zone eastward along the Miami Main Channel. The extension was established to include the new cruise ship terminal at the Port of Miami added in December 2024. This action extends existing fixed security zone approximately 840 yards eastward along the Miami Main Channel. | 2024-12-27 | 2024 | 12 | https://www.federalregister.gov/documents/2024/12/27/2024-30598/security-zone-port-of-miami-florida | https://www.govinfo.gov/content/pkg/FR-2024-12-27/pdf/2024-30598.pdf | Homeland Security Department; Coast Guard | 227,53 | The Coast Guard is changing the existing Port of Miami fixed security zone regulation that encompasses certain navigable waters of the Miami Main Channel in Miami, FL.
